Firmware release 2.2.58 was suppose to maintain legacy functionality but allow gen 4 app access to legacy devices.
It appears that the extend live functionality has been changed.
Proper legacy extend live functionality is the extend time is 50% of the record time up a maximum of 2 hours. Last night I recorded the 3 hour MLB Dodgers game on a gen 3 without the new firmware and a gen 2 with the new firmware.
The old firmware had the extend time at 1 1/2 hours and the new firmware at 30 minutes.
